English: Weare Giffard: Wear Mills. On a leat by the river Torridge; in the 18th and 19th century barges would bring grain on the top of the tide from Bideford. By 1889 the mill was fitted with a turbine and roller milling machinery by Henry Simon of Manchester; the turbine was appropriate as the Torridge is liable to flood. The mill has been converted to a private residence |
